đ Black History Month at LBCC | February Events đ
Celebrate Black voices, legacy, and storytelling at Linn-Benton Community College Albany Campus in the Equity Center (Forum 220), with a month-long series of powerful events:
Join Dr. Ramycia McGhee from 11 a.m. to 12 p.m. on February 4 as she explores the roots, milestones, and meaning behind Black History Month in a thoughtful opening talk.
On February 11 from 11 a.m. to 12 p.m., Professor Jasmine La Rue takes the mic to spotlight the cultural impact of Black storytelling in Hollywood and how it continues to shape representation.
Dive into stories of history and community with a screening of the PBS documentary, Preserving Our Past: Kansas City Stories of Black History â The Story Continues, on February 19 from 12 to 1 p.m.
Then, close out the month with Mariah Rocker of Oregon Black Pioneers from 11 a.m. to 12 p.m. on February 25 as she bridges the stories of past trailblazers with todayâs changemakers.
